在学习VB(Visual Basic)编程语言的过程中,掌握基本的概念和语法是非常重要的一步。为了帮助大家更好地理解和应用VB知识,这里整理了一些常见的VB考试试题,并附上详细的答案解析。
一、选择题
1. 下列哪个是VB中的循环结构?
A. for...next
B. if...then
C. while...do
D. switch...case
正确答案:A
解析:在VB中,for...next是用来实现循环结构的关键字,用于重复执行一段代码直到满足特定条件为止。而if...then用于条件判断,while...do虽然也是循环结构但在VB中并不常用,switch...case也不是VB中的关键字。
2. 如何声明一个整型变量?
A. Dim x As Integer
B. Integer x
C. Var x = 0
D. Declare x As Int
正确答案:A
解析:在VB中,使用Dim关键字来声明变量,并且需要指定数据类型。选项A正确地展示了如何声明一个整型变量。选项B不符合VB语法;选项C是JavaScript的语法;选项D错误地拼写了Declare。
二、填空题
1. 在VB中,用来表示注释的符号是_________。
答案:'
解析:在VB中,单引号(')被用来表示一行的注释。任何跟在单引号后面的内容都会被视为注释,不会被执行。
2. VB中的数组下标从_________开始计数。
答案:0
解析:与一些其他编程语言不同,VB中的数组下标是从0开始计数的。这意味着第一个元素的位置是索引0。
三、编程题
编写一个程序,计算1到100之间所有偶数的和。
```vb
Sub Main()
Dim sum As Integer = 0
For i As Integer = 1 To 100
If i Mod 2 = 0 Then
sum += i
End If
Next
Console.WriteLine("1到100之间所有偶数的和为:" & sum)
End Sub
```
解析:此程序通过for循环遍历1到100之间的数字,使用if语句检查每个数字是否为偶数(即能被2整除)。如果是偶数,则将其加入到sum变量中。最后输出结果。
以上就是一些基础的VB考试题目及其解析。希望这些练习能够帮助你巩固所学的知识点,提高你的编程技能。继续努力,不断实践,相信你会越来越熟练!